Human α-synuclein (α-Syn) is instrumental in maintaining homeostasis of monoamine neurotransmitters in brain, through its trafficking, and regulation of the cell surface expression and, thereby, activity of dopamine, serotonin and norepinephrine transporters. Here we have investigated whether other members of the synuclein family of proteins, γ-synuclein (γ-Syn) and β-synuclein (β-Syn) can similarly modulate the serotonin transporter (SERT). In Ltk cells co-transfected with SERT and γ-Syn, γ-Syn reduced [3H]5-HT uptake, in a manner dependent on its expression levels. The decrease in SERT activity was via decreased Vmax of the transporter, without change in Km, compared to cells expressing only SERT. By contrast, β-Syn co-expression failed to alter SERT uptake activity, and neither the Vmax nor the Km was changed in the presence of β-Syn. γ-Syn modulation of SERT was only partial, with a maximal ∼27% decrease in SERT activity seen even at high expression levels of γ-Syn. By contrast, α-Syn attenuated SERT activity by ∼65% at identical expression levels as γ-Syn. Co-immunoprecipitation studies showed the presence of heteromeric protein:protein complexes between γ-Syn or α-Syn and SERT, while β-Syn failed to physically interact with SERT. Both α-Syn and γ-Syn colocalized with SERT in rat primary raphae nuclei neurons. These studies document a novel physiological role for γ-Syn in regulating 5-HT synaptic availability and homeostasis, and may be of relevance in depression and mood disorders, where SERT function is dysregulated.  相似文献

Background: The purpose of the present study was to compare iissue harmonic imaging (THI) and conventional sonography in focal hepatic lesions. Methods: Fifty patients with focal hepatic lesions were enrolled for study. Conventional grayscale and THI was performed in all the patients and two sets of images of the lesions were recorded (one each for THI and conventional) and assessed for fluid–solid differentiation, detail and overall image quality. These images were compared with conventional sonographic images and graded better, same or worse as per the case. Lesions were confirmed by fine‐needle aspiration cytology (FNAC)/surgery/other modalities such as computed tomography (CT) or magnetic resonance imaging (MRI). Results: Out of 50 patients with focal hepatic lesions, 21 patients had metastatic lesions (two single; 19 multiple) five patients had hepatocellular carcinoma (HCC), five patients had hydatid cysts, nine had simple hepatic cyst whereas five patients had liver abscess, three had focal fatty infiltration; and lymphoma and hemangioma were seen in one patient each. The first observer ranked THI better than standard sonography in 40 patients (80%) for fluid–solid differentiation, in 38 (76%) for detail and in 39 (78%) for overall image quality. The second observer ranked THI better than standard sonography in 39 patients (78%) for fluid–solid differentiation, in 40 (80%) for detail and in 42 (84%) for overall image quality. Tissue harmonic imaging provided additional information in eight patients (16%) and resulted in treatment alteration in three patients (6%). Conclusion: Tissue harmonic imaging was significantly better than conventional sonography for fluid–solid differentiation, detail and total image quality in focal hepatic lesions, especially in obese patients and patients with poor acoustic window.  相似文献

Non invasive ventilation refers to the technique of providing ventilatory support without a direct conduit to the airway. It is a promising new technique, which is particularly useful in patients with COPD. Patients with COPD are prone to develop acute exacerbations, which pushes them into acute respiratory failure. Under these circumstances, tracheal intubation and mechanical ventilation is associated with significant morbidity and mortality. A number of well conducted studies support the fact that non invasive positive pressure ventilation (NIPPV) in these circumstances reduces rates of intubation, mortality, complications and duration of hospital stay. The biggest advantage of these techniques is their simplicity, ease of implementation and improved patient comfort allowing them to retain important functions like speech, cough and swallowing. NIPPV should be instituted early in the course of acute respiratory failure due to COPD before irreversible fatigue sets in. The current thinking is that NIPPV rests the respiratory muscles allowing other therapies time to be effective. Facilities for NIPPV should be available in all hospitals admitting patients with respiratory failure. Patients with severe, stable COPD who are hypercapnic and are deteriorating despite maximal conventional treatment should definitely be offered a trial of NIPPV. In such patients NIPPV has been shown to improve quality of life, reverse blood gas abnormalities, improve exercise tolerance and reduce hospital admissions. Physicians must familiarize themselves with this promising new ventilatory technique.  相似文献

Background

Electronic cigarette awareness and use has been increasing rapidly. E-cigarette brands have utilized social networking sites to promote their products, as the growth of the e-cigarette industry has paralleled that of Web 2.0. These online platforms are cost-effective and have unique technological features and user demographics that can be attractive for selective marketing. The popularity of multiple sites also poses a risk of exposure to social networks where e-cigarette brands might not have a presence.

Objective

To examine the marketing strategies of leading e-cigarette brands on multiple social networking sites, and to identify how affordances of the digital media are used to their advantage. Secondary analyses include determining if any brands are benefitting from site demographics, and exploring cross-site diffusion of marketing content through multi-site users.

Methods

We collected data from two e-cigarette brands from four social networking sites over approximately 2.5 years. Content analysis is used to search for themes, population targeting, marketing strategies, and cross-site spread of messages.

Results

Twitter appeared to be the most frequently used social networking site for interacting directly with product users. Facebook supported informational broadcasts, such as announcements regarding political legislation. E-cigarette brands also differed in their approaches to their users, from informal conversations to direct product marketing.

Conclusions

E-cigarette makers use different strategies to market their product and engage their users. There was no evidence of direct targeting of vulnerable populations, but the affordances of the different sites are exploited to best broadcast context-specific messages. We developed a viable method to study cross-site diffusion, although additional refinement is needed to account for how different types of digital media are used.  相似文献

Aim

To estimate global morbidity from acute bacterial meningitis in children.

Methods

We conducted a systematic review of the PubMed and Scopus databases to identify both community-based and hospital registry-based studies that could be useful in estimation of the global morbidity from bacterial meningitis in children. We were primarily interested in the availability and quality of the information on incidence rates and case-fatality rates. We assessed the impact of the year of study, study design, study setting, the duration of study, and sample size on reported incidence values, and also any association between incidence and case-fatality rate. We also categorized the studies by 6 World Health Organization regions and analyzed the plausibility of estimates derived from the current evidence using median and inter-quartile range of the available reports in each region.

Results

We found 71 studies that met the inclusion criteria. The only two significant associations between the reported incidence and studied covariates were the negative correlation between the incidence and sample size (P < 0.001) and positive correlation between incidence and case-fatality rate (P < 0.001). The median incidence per 100 000 child-years was highest in the African region – 143.6 (interquartile range [IQR] 115.6-174.6), followed by Western Pacific region with 42.9 (12.4-83.4), the Eastern Mediterranean region with 34.3 (9.9-42.0), South East Asia with 26.8 (21.0-60.3), Europe with 20.8 (16.2-29.7), and American region with 16.6 (10.3-33.7). The median case-fatality rate was also highest in the African region (31.3%). Globally, the median incidence for all 71 studies was 34.0 (16.0-88.0) per 100 000 child-years, with a median case-fatality rate of 14.4% (5.3%-26.2%).

Conclusions

Our study showed that there was now sufficient evidence to generate improved and internally consistent estimates of the global burden of acute bacterial meningitis in children. Although some of our region-specific estimates are very uncertain due to scarcity of data from the corresponding regions, the estimates of morbidity and case-fatality from childhood bacterial meningitis derived from this study are consistent with mortality estimates derived from multi-cause mortality studies. Both lines of evidence imply that bacterial meningitis is a cause of 2% of all child deaths.Meningitis is an infectious disease affecting the brain membrane and spinal cord (1). Globally, bacterial meningitis is the most severe type of meningitis, mainly caused by a triad of species Neisseria meningitidis, Streptocccus pneumonia, and Haemophilus influenzae (2). While viral meningitis is usually a self-limiting disease with good prognosis, bacterial meningitis is potentially fatal, requiring urgent medical assistance and management with antibiotics treatment (3). Various estimates of the burden of bacterial meningitis have been proposed to date, but they have mainly focused on mortality (4), long-term sequels (5), or etiology-specific morbidity and mortality (6-8).Interestingly, there have been no comprehensive attempts to estimate the overall global burden of bacterial meningitis in children. This is not surprising, because such attempt would face almost insurmountable methodological challenges. First, there is a problem with case definition of “bacterial meningitis” (9). In low resource settings, where the problem is most common, many children may present with “purulent meningitis,” whose cause is highly likely bacterial, but laboratory capacity may not be sufficient to isolate the causal agent and confirm the diagnosis. This leads to a discrepancy between morbidity burden estimates based on “all purulent meningitis” and “laboratory confirmed meningitis” – the latter always being lower than the former, but to a different extent in different contexts (10). The second large methodological obstacle is the problem of “meningitis belt.” The meningitis belt is the band of countries extending from Senegal to Ethiopia, characterized by semi-arid climate, dry seasons, and dusty winds, with seasonal outbreaks of meningococcal meningitis being recorded since the beginning of the 20th century (11). The problem with these epidemics is that they can last for several years and dramatically change the importance of meningococcus in comparison to the other two bacterial agents (S. pneumoniae and H. influenzae) both regionally and globally (11). This makes it difficult to express the “burden of disease” for any given year, because it will be very different in intra-epidemic and inter-epidemic years. Moreover, the extent of vaccine coverage against N. meningitidis, S. pneumoniae and H. influenzae is changing the burden rapidly and rather dramatically in many places, rendering the scarce evidence from before the period of vaccination rather useless and indicates a need of revision (12). Finally, the emergence of HIV/AIDS pandemic led to a substantial number of infected children, whose resistance to other infections is impaired and they present a specific category of population in which the rates of incidence and case-fatality rates may be very different from those in other children (13).It is apparent that meningitis continues to contribute significantly to global mortality and morbidity, but the impact of the efforts to control it is difficult to estimate given that we do not have comprehensive estimates of global morbidity patterns. Understanding the global morbidity from bacterial meningitis would be useful because it would also help to validate the existing mortality estimates through application of appropriate case-fatality rates. The purpose of the present study is to provide a comprehensive assessment of the evidence that is available for estimating the global morbidity from acute bacterial meningitis in children globally. We will also propose initial, robust estimates of the burden, with suggestions on the possible ways to address the methodological challenges in future studies.  相似文献

IntroductionFocal nodular hyperplasia, a benign liver tumour, is the second most common focal benign liver lesion, after a cavernous haemangioma. Contrast-enhanced ultrasound is used increasingly for the diagnostic work up and follow-up of focal liver lesions in adults, but is particularly valuable in the paediatric population, with the ability to reduce radiation and the nephrotoxic contrast agents used in computed tomography or magnetic resonance imaging. Confident recognition of focal nodular hyperplasia is important; it is benign, usually asymptomatic, of no clinical significance, of no clinical consequence or malignant potential. We present a case of focal nodular hyperplasia of the liver with its characteristic findings on conventional ultrasound, contrast-enhanced ultrasound with quantitative analysis and correlated with magnetic resonance imaging.Case presentation: A 15-year-old female with right upper quadrant abdominal pain was referred for liver ultrasound. A focal liver lesion was detected on B-mode ultrasound examination, and colour Doppler demonstrated no specific features. Contrast-enhanced ultrasound examination demonstrated early arterial enhancement, with a characteristic spoke-wheel pattern, centrifugal uniform filling of the lesion on the late arterial phase and sustained enhancement on the portal venous phase. Quantitative contrast-enhanced ultrasound has been performed, showing a typical curve of enhancement, as well as characteristic parametric images, supporting the interpretation of contrast-enhanced ultrasound and assisting the diagnosis. Magnetic resonance imaging demonstrated a central T2 hyperintense scar and similar enhancement characteristics as contrast-enhanced ultrasound on T1 gadolinium-enhanced sequences.ConclusionContrast-enhanced ultrasound is a useful technique for the differentiation of benign from malignant liver lesions and has the potential to establish the diagnosis of focal nodular hyperplasia, based on the enhancement pattern, which is similar to that observed on magnetic resonance imaging but can be better appreciated with superior temporal, contrast and spatial resolution of contrast-enhanced ultrasound.  相似文献
